Hello Betsy - welcome to the Forum.

Here are some distances of towns from Santiago and how many days it will take you from each if you walk 20kms per day or 25kms per day.

Town Kms 20km or 25km per day

Burgos 488 24 20

Leon 308 15 12

Astorga 260 13 10

O Cebreiro 158 8 6

Sarria 115 6 5

Santiago


Based on these distances, you could start at Astorga (good place to start) and reach Santiago in 2 weeks.

You can get to Burgos from most Spanish destinations - either by train or bus.

When are you planning to walk?
 
The best route from Boston is to fly direct to Madrid (Continental, US Air....). Other routes (Paris or London) may be cheaper but you have to be prepared to wait for connections in terminals, both going and coming back.

From the airport a short bus/subway or taxi to Avenida de Americas bus terminal. Frequent buses go to Burgos.
